VHP On Opposition Leaders: VHP’s letter to Ayodhya Police in Ram Mandir donation theft case, demanding to take evidence from these opposition leaders regarding the allegations.


New Delhi. Opposition parties are continuously blaming RSS, Vishwa Hindu Parishad (VHP) and BJP in the case of theft of Ram Temple donations. Especially Arvind Kejriwal, Congress and Samajwadi Party are vocal in this matter. Now VHP has also opened a front against the opposition leaders. VHP’s international president and senior lawyer Alok Kumar has written a letter to Ayodhya Police DSP Ashutosh Tiwari. With this, one end of the investigation into donation theft may also turn towards these opposition leaders.

VHP International President Alok Kumar has demanded in his letter that Ayodhya Police should record the statements of those leaders including Arvind Kejriwal, Aam Aadmi Party MP Sanjay Singh, SP MP Ramgopal Yadav and Congress MP Priyanka Gandhi Vadra and seek information about the facts, sources and documents regarding the allegations of donation theft being made by them. Let us tell you that Sanjay Singh had recently given some documents to the SIT investigating the theft of Ram Mandir donation. Police have so far arrested 8 accused in the Ram Mandir donation theft case. The police have recovered an amount of about Rs 80 lakh from all of them. The police is also investigating everyone’s bank accounts, land and vehicle purchase deals. UP CM Yogi Adityanath has clearly said that his government will not spare anyone involved in the theft of Ram Temple donations. At the same time, R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at has called the people involved in donation theft as big sinners. RSS Sar Karyavah Dattatreya Hosabale has also termed the incident as condemnable and demanded strict punishment for the culprits. VHP has also demanded strict punishment. Despite this, opposition parties are continuously targeting Sangh Parivar and BJP.
